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brazilian Big-eyed Bat | Brown Zygodont |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(hayvan) | Animalia (hayvan)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Kordalılar) | Chordata (Kordalılar) |
| Class same | Mammalia (memeliler) | Mammalia (memeliler) |
| Order | Chiroptera (yarasa) | Rodentia (kemiriciler)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Chiroderma | Zygodontomys |
| Species | Chiroderma doriae | Zygodontomys brunneus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brazilian Big-eyed Bat and Brown Zygodont share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(memeliler)
